你查询的IP:[116.4.61.226]  地理位置:中国–广东–东莞

最新查询59.108.249.219 61.232.41.79 221.198.6.37 116.1.74.135 61.28.251.55 123.4.164.35 121.56.99.20 125.98.48.11 59.107.28.1 116.4.61.226 202.181.112.111 118.124.18.238 124.243.192.32 202.38.160.61 203.90.128.205 169.211.1.6 198.17.7.154 119.248.147.124 123.196.166.89 125.214.96.79 119.176.209.102 221.208.87.185 119.84.173.250 210.56.192.63 202.127.16.29 119.59.128.64 221.208.95.150 116.2.24.70 202.22.248.65 166.111.190.77 116.1.162.221